What is Visceral Fat?
Visceral fat is a type of fat that is stored deep within the abdominal cavity and is not easily seen. It plays a critical role in overall health, as excess visceral fat is strongly associated with metabolic syndrome and increased risks of diseases. Unlike subcutaneous fat, which is located just under the skin, visceral fat poses a greater threat due to its proximity to vital organs.
The Role of HGH in Fat Metabolism
HGH influences metabolism in several ways:
- Stimulates Lipolysis: HGH promotes the breakdown of fats in the body, leading to a reduction in fat stores.
- Increases Muscle Mass: Higher levels of HGH contribute to increased muscle growth, which in turn boosts metabolism and helps in the burning of excess fat.
- Regulates Insulin Sensitivity: HGH plays a role in improving insulin sensitivity, which can assist in better fat management and reduced storage of visceral fat.
